The ROI of Kitchen Remodels

Homeowners often remodel with resale in mind, and a kitchen upgrade tends to deliver one of the highest returns on investment (ROI). According to industry reports, a minor kitchen remodel can recoup about 70–80% of its cost when selling your home, while major remodels often recover slightly less, around 60–65%. The reason? Prospective buyers are drawn to homes with modern, functional kitchens.

A well-executed kitchen remodel can make your home stand out in a competitive market, attracting higher offers and faster sales. Even if you’re not planning to sell, the improved usability and style make the investment worthwhile.

Factors That Impact the Value Added by a Kitchen Remodel

Not all kitchen remodels are created equal. Several factors influence how much value your upgrade will add:

  1. Neighborhood Trends: If you live in an area where gourmet kitchens are common, an upscale remodel may yield better returns. Conversely, a simpler update may be more appropriate for modest neighborhoods.
  2. Project Scope: The scale of your remodel matters. Larger projects cost more, so the ROI may differ compared to smaller upgrades.
  3. Market Conditions: In a seller’s market, where demand outweighs supply, buyers are more willing to pay a premium for updated homes.

Understanding these factors helps you prioritize upgrades that align with your budget and market expectations.

Comparing Minor vs. Major Kitchen Remodels: Which Yields Better Value?

When it comes to ROI, minor kitchen remodels often provide better value. Why? They focus on high-impact, cost-effective changes like updating cabinet fronts, swapping out old countertops, or upgrading appliances. These improvements create a fresh, modern look without the expense of tearing everything down.

On the other hand, major remodels involve extensive changes like reconfiguring layouts, adding square footage, or installing custom cabinetry. While these projects can drastically transform your kitchen, their higher costs mean the ROI is typically lower.

If you’re remodeling with resale in mind, a well-planned minor upgrade might be the smarter choice.

Which Kitchen Updates Have the Highest Returns?

Certain updates consistently deliver higher returns because they appeal to most buyers. Here are a few to consider:

  1. Cabinets: Refacing or painting cabinets is a cost-effective way to refresh your kitchen.
  2. Countertops: Durable, attractive materials like quartz or granite are always a hit.
  3. Appliances: Energy-efficient models not only look sleek but also appeal to eco-conscious buyers.
  4. Lighting: Modern fixtures and under-cabinet lighting can transform the ambiance.
  5. Backsplashes: A stylish backsplash adds personality without breaking the bank.

Choosing timeless designs and neutral colors can maximize your kitchen remodel’s impact, appealing to a broader range of buyers.
